Author: mareshkau
Date: 2010-09-21 10:03:39 -0400 (Tue, 21 Sep 2010)
New Revision: 25053
Modified:
trunk/jst/plugins/org.jboss.tools.jst.jsp/src/org/jboss/tools/jst/jsp/jspeditor/JSPMultiPageEditorPart.java
Log:
JBIDE-7059,layout problem has been corrected
Modified:
trunk/jst/plugins/org.jboss.tools.jst.jsp/src/org/jboss/tools/jst/jsp/jspeditor/JSPMultiPageEditorPart.java
===================================================================
---
trunk/jst/plugins/org.jboss.tools.jst.jsp/src/org/jboss/tools/jst/jsp/jspeditor/JSPMultiPageEditorPart.java 2010-09-21
13:31:55 UTC (rev 25052)
+++
trunk/jst/plugins/org.jboss.tools.jst.jsp/src/org/jboss/tools/jst/jsp/jspeditor/JSPMultiPageEditorPart.java 2010-09-21
14:03:39 UTC (rev 25053)
@@ -10,6 +10,7 @@
******************************************************************************/
package org.jboss.tools.jst.jsp.jspeditor;
+import java.awt.Color;
import java.util.ArrayList;
import java.util.Iterator;
@@ -89,9 +90,18 @@
editor.init(site, input);
parent2 = new Composite(getContainer(), SWT.NONE);
ppp = parent2;
- editor.createPartControl(parent2);
+ if(editor==sourcePart){
+ //case when only source part available
+ Composite editorComp = new Composite(parent2, SWT.NONE);
+ editorComp.setLayout(new FillLayout());
+ GridData editorGD=new GridData(GridData.FILL_BOTH);
+ editorGD.horizontalSpan=2;
+ editorComp.setLayoutData(editorGD);
+ editor.createPartControl(editorComp);
+ }else {
+ editor.createPartControl(parent2);
+ }
parent2.setLayout(new GridLayout(2, false));
-
selectionBar = new SelectionBar(sourcePart);
selectionBar.createToolBarComposite(parent2);
editor.addPropertyListener(new IPropertyListener() {
Show replies by date